**The Significance of Explosion-Proof Tactical LED Lighting**
The primary purpose of explosion-proof lighting is to ensure safety in environments where flammable gases, vapors, or dust may be present. In China, where the industrial sector is a vital component of the economy, the demand for such lighting solutions has surged. The integration of tactical LED technology has further enhanced the capabilities of explosion-proof lighting, making it more efficient, durable, and versatile.

**Applications in Various Industries**
The versatility of explosion-proof tactical LED lighting makes it suitable for a wide range of applications across various industries in China. Some of the key sectors include:
1. **Petroleum and Chemical Industry**: This industry relies heavily on explosion-proof lighting to ensure safety in refineries, chemical plants, and storage facilities.
2. **Mining Industry**: Mining operations often involve hazardous environments, making explosion-proof lighting essential for ensuring the safety of workers.
3. **Manufacturing Sector**: Factories and industrial facilities require reliable lighting solutions to enhance productivity and safety.
4. **Transportation Infrastructure**: Bridges, tunnels, and other transportation infrastructure benefit from explosion-proof lighting, ensuring safety and visibility.
